The measured sermorelin benefits in older adults are narrower and more interesting than the marketing suggests. In a placebo-controlled trial of a GHRH (1-29) analogue in age-advanced men and women, twelve-hour integrated nocturnal growth hormone rose significantly in both sexes, IGF-1 and IGFBP-3 increased within two weeks, and skin thickness improved in both — but lean body mass rose in men only, with no other change in body composition or bone mineral density (Khorram, Laughlin & Yen, J Clin Endocrinol Metab 1997).
What sermorelin actually does
Sermorelin is the first 29 amino acids of growth hormone-releasing hormone — the fragment that carries the biological activity. It is not growth hormone. It is the signal that tells your pituitary to release its own.
That one mechanical fact explains most of what follows. Because the pituitary remains in charge, release stays pulsatile and the feedback system that normally regulates it stays intact — somatostatin can still apply the brake. You get a nudge to a system rather than an override of it.
The consequences run in both directions. The upside is a safety profile shaped by your own physiology rather than by an externally imposed level. The limit is that a pituitary which cannot respond will not be made to, so sermorelin's ceiling is set by what your own gland can still do. That is the core of the sermorelin versus HGH comparison.
The measured sermorelin benefits, in order of evidence
Growth hormone and IGF-1 rise. This is the best-supported effect and the one everything else depends on. In the trial above, IGF-1 and its binding protein climbed within two weeks of starting. Studies of nightly GHRH in healthy elderly men found the releasing response was sustained across six weeks rather than fading, with no significant adverse effects (Vittone et al., Metabolism 1997) — the axis kept answering.
Skin thickness. Significantly increased in both men and women in the Khorram trial. A small, objectively measured, real finding.
Lean body mass. Increased in men only, and not in women. That asymmetry is exactly the sort of detail promotional copy tends to lose.
Sleep. Growth hormone release is physiologically tied to slow-wave sleep, which is why sermorelin is typically dosed at night, and improved sleep quality is among the most consistent things users report. It is also the least well quantified in controlled trials — mechanistically coherent, experientially common, formally under-studied.
Body composition and bone density beyond the above. The trial found no other changes. Worth stating plainly, because the gap between "IGF-1 went up" and "your body recomposed" is where most overclaiming happens.
What sermorelin is not
It is not a substitute for growth hormone in someone whose pituitary cannot produce it. It is not a rapid intervention — the trial data measures effects over weeks to months, and the endocrine markers move well before anything subjective does. And it is not a weight-loss drug; the studied effects on body composition were modest, sex-specific and secondary.

Who tends to be a candidate
Sermorelin is generally considered for adults whose own growth hormone output has declined with age and who have symptoms consistent with that — poor sleep quality, slow recovery, changes in body composition — rather than for anyone wanting a performance edge. Baseline labs, including IGF-1 and thyroid function, inform the decision, and untreated hypothyroidism should be corrected first because it blunts the response.
What rules people out matters as much: an active cancer diagnosis, pregnancy or breastfeeding, growth hormone deficiency stemming from an intracranial lesion, or known sensitivity to the formulation. Growth hormone and IGF-1 are growth-signalling pathways, and raising them deliberately is not a decision to make around an untreated malignancy.
The common side effects are mild and mostly local — injection-site reactions in roughly one patient in six, with almost everything else under 1%. We cover them in sermorelin side effects.

Setting expectations honestly
The strongest claim the evidence supports is that sermorelin reliably raises your own growth hormone and IGF-1, with a mild side-effect profile, and that this is associated with measurable changes in skin thickness and — in men — lean mass. Everything beyond that is either under-studied or extrapolated.
That is a real result. It is not the transformation the category is often sold as, and knowing the difference before you start is the best predictor of being satisfied with what you get.
